Transaction 8c96cd7b4ab137ebfa448888dc00ee104d7324ffd02c02dbbcdc9f848f5640b6
1 Input
1 Output
-
8c96cd7b4ab137ebfa448888dc00ee104d7324ffd02c02dbbcdc9f848f5640b6:0
- value
- 377132
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d95b19d9f6ee718779da873edddc39f6b514f4ac OP_EQUAL
- address
- 3MWHgygnnbCWfbaCmFXJDnyEWfP3kcNPTF